ich habe letzten Samstag meine DBox2 nach der MHC Methode in den Debug Mode gebracht. Hat dank der guten Anleitung von dietmar-h und den Tips hier im Forum auch auf Anhieb geklappt. Nach dem Auslesen des Original BS und dem extrahieren der uCodes habe ich das AlexW 1.6.8 Image geflasht. Auch dies hat ohne Probleme geklappt.
Nun zu meinem Problem:
Die Box findet nit dem AlexW Image weder unter Neutrino noch unter Enigma Sender.
Bisher habe ich Flgendes Versucht:
1. Original BS aufgespielt. Box findet Sender
2. AlexW 1.6 aufgespielt. uCodes und CDK Cramfs raufgeladen. Keine Sender.
3. Ein Image welches ich von einem Bekannten bekommen habe aufgespielt. Sender werden gefunden. Ich möchte das Image aber nicht auf der Box haben, weil ich ein ABO und keinen Stall habe.

4. Verschiedene YADD's ausprobiert. Keine Sender.
5. Nochmals AlexW 1.6.8 aufgespielt. Keine Sender (Details siehe unten)
6. Original BS aufgespielt. Box findet Sender.
Details:
DBox2 Sagem 2xI
BMon 1.0
BR 2.01
ucode.bin hat die Gösse 2048
cam-alpha hat die Grösse 84400
avia600 hat die Grösse 128214
avia500 hat die Grösse 101374
LOG vom Flashen:
debug: DDF: Calibrating delay loop... debug: DDF: 66.76 BogoMIPS
debug: BMon V1.0 mID 03
debug: feID 00 enxID 03
debug: fpID 52 dsID 01-73.8d.0d.07.00.00-3c
debug: HWrev 01 FPrev 0.23
debug: B/Ex/Fl(MB) 32/00/08
WATCHDOG reset enabled
dbox2:root> debug:
BOOTP/TFTP bootstrap loader (v0.3)
debug:
debug: Transmitting BOOTP request via broadcast
debug: Got BOOTP reply from Server IP 192.168.19.200, My IP 192.168.19.99
debug: Sending TFTP-request for file C/Programme/DBoxBoot/ppcboot_writeflash
will verify ELF image, start= 0x800000, size= 201596
verify sig: 262
boot net: boot file has no valid signature
Branching to 0x40000
ppcboot 0.6.4 (Apr 11 2002 - 16:10:44)
Initializing...
CPU: PPC823ZTnnB2 at 66 MHz: 2 kB I-Cache 1 kB D-Cache
Board: ### No HW ID - assuming TQM8xxL
DRAM: (faked) 32 MB
Ethernet: xx-xx-xx-xx-xx-xx
FLASH: 8 MB
LCD driver (KS0713) initialized
BOOTP broadcast 1
TFTP from server 192.168.19.200; our IP address is 192.168.19.99
Filename 'C/Programme/tftpboot/logo-lcd'.
Load address: 0x130000
Loading: ##

LCD logo at: 0x130000 (0x1F9FFC0 bytes)
BOOTP broadcast 1
TFTP from server 192.168.19.200; our IP address is 192.168.19.99
Filename 'C/Programme/tftpboot/logo-fb'.
Load address: 0x120000
Loading: #########

FB logo at: 0x0 (0x1FC0000 bytes)
AVIA Frambuffer
Input: serial
Output: serial
1: Console on ttyS0
2: Console on null
3: Console on framebuffer
Select (1-3), other keys to stop autoboot: 0
dbox2-ppcboot> bootp 120000 /D/DBox2/Images/AlexW/alexW2xBaseimageV1.6.8/alexW2x
BaseimageV1.6.8.img
BOOTP broadcast 1
TFTP from server 192.168.19.200; our IP address is 192.168.19.99
Filename '/D/DBox2/Images/AlexW/alexW2xBaseimageV1.6.8/alexW2xBaseimageV1.6.8.im
g'.
Load address: 0x120000
Loading: #######################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
################################################################################
######################

dbox2-ppcboot> protect off 10020000 107fffff
...............................................................
Un-Protected 63 sectors
dbox2-ppcboot> erase 10020000 107fffff
Erase Flash from 0x10020000 to 0x107fffff
sector 66 ....

Erased 63 sectors
dbox2-ppcboot> cp.l 120000 10020000 1F8000
Copy to Flash...

nach dem flaschen beim ersten Hochfahren,wie verlangt, IP Adresse vergeben, cdk camfs nach /tmp und ucodes nach /ucodes geladen.
Box meldet Lösche Flash und danach Beschreibe Flash.
Nach dem Neustart
Boot.log:
debug: DDF: Calibrating delay loop... debug: DDF: 66.76 BogoMIPS
debug: BMon V1.0 mID 03
debug: feID 00 enxID 03
debug: fpID 52 dsID 01-73.8d.0d.07.00.00-3c
debug: HWrev 01 FPrev 0.23
debug: B/Ex/Fl(MB) 32/00/08
WATCHDOG reset enabled
dbox2:root> debug:
BOOTP/TFTP bootstrap loader (v0.3)
debug:
debug: Transmitting BOOTP request via broadcast
debug: Given up BOOTP/TFTP boot
boot net failed
Flash-FS bootstrap loader (v1.5)
Found Flash-FS superblock version 3.1
Found file /root/platform/sagem-dbox2/kernel/os in Flash-FS
debug: Got Block #0052
will verify ELF image, start= 0x800000, size= 203620
verify sig: 262
Branching to 0x40000
PPCBoot 1.1.6 (TuxBox) (Feb 17 2003 - 19:30:34)
CPU: PPC823ZTnnB2 at 66 MHz: 2 kB I-Cache 1 kB D-Cache
Watchdog enabled
Board: DBOX2, Sagem
I2C: ready
DRAM: 32 MB
FLASH: 8 MB
Scanning JFFS2 FS: . Unknown node type: e002 len 92 offset 0x54ba4

LCD: ready
FB: loading - ready
In: serial
Out: serial
Err: serial
Options:
1: Console on null
2: Console on ttyS0
3: Console on framebuffer
Select (1-3), other keys to stop autoboot: 0
...............................................................
Un-Protected 63 sectors
### FS (cramfs) loading 'vmlinuz' to 0x100000
### FS load compleate: 635491 bytes loaded to 0x100000
## Booting image at 00100000 ...
Image Name: dbox2
Image Type: PowerPC Linux Kernel Image (gzip compressed)
Data Size: 635427 Bytes = 620 kB = 0 MB
Load Address: 00000000
Entry Point: 00000000
Verifying Checksum ... OK
Uncompressing Kernel Image ... OK
Linux version 2.4.20 (von alexW) Wer Kernels nachmacht, oder faelscht, wird best
raft ;-) #1 Fre Feb 28 20:20:56 CET 2003
On node 0 totalpages: 8192
zone(0): 8192 pages.
zone(1): 0 pages.
zone(2): 0 pages.
Kernel command line: root=/dev/mtdblock2 console=ttyS0
Decrementer Frequency = 247500000/60
mpc8xx-wdt: active wdt found (SWTC: 0xFFFF, SWP: 0x1)
mpc8xx-wdt: keep-alive trigger activated (PITC: 0x2000)
Console: colour dummy device 80x25
Calibrating delay loop... 65.74 BogoMIPS
Memory: 30812k available (1120k kernel code, 376k data, 60k init, 0k highmem)
Dentry cache hash table entries: 4096 (order: 3, 32768 bytes)
Inode cache hash table entries: 2048 (order: 2, 16384 bytes)
Mount-cache hash table entries: 512 (order: 0, 4096 bytes)
Buffer-cache hash table entries: 1024 (order: 0, 4096 bytes)
Page-cache hash table entries: 8192 (order: 3, 32768 bytes)
POSIX conformance testing by UNIFIX
Linux NET4.0 for Linux 2.4
Based upon Swansea University Computer Society NET3.039
Initializing RT netlink socket
Starting kswapd
devfs: v1.12c (20020818) Richard Gooch (rgooch@atnf.csiro.au)
devfs: boot_options: 0x1
JFFS2 version 2.1. (C) 2001, 2002 Red Hat, Inc., designed by Axis Communications
AB.
i2c-core.o: i2c core module
CPM UART driver version 0.03
ttyS00 at 0x0280 is a SMC
ttyS01 at 0x0380 is a SMC
pty: 256 Unix98 ptys configured
eth0: CPM ENET Version 0.2 on SCC2, 00:50:9c:30:66:69
D-Box 2 flash driver (size->0x800000 mem->0x10000000)
cfi_cmdset_0001: Erase suspend on write enabled
Using word write method
Creating 6 MTD partitions on "D-Box 2 flash memory":
0x00000000-0x00020000 : "BR bootloader"
0x00020000-0x00040000 : "flfs (ppcboot)"
0x00040000-0x00720000 : "root (cramfs)"
0x00720000-0x00800000 : "var (jffs2)"
0x00020000-0x00800000 : "flash without bootloader"
0x00000000-0x00800000 : "complete flash"
mice: PS/2 mouse device common for all mice
NET4: Linux TCP/IP 1.0 for NET4.0
IP Protocols: ICMP, UDP, TCP
IP: routing cache hash table of 512 buckets, 4Kbytes
TCP: Hash tables configured (established 2048 bind 4096)
NET4: Unix domain sockets 1.0/SMP for Linux NET4.0.
VFS: Mounted root (cramfs filesystem) readonly.
Mounted devfs on /dev
Freeing unused kernel memory: 60k init
init started: BusyBox v0.61.pre (2002.09.22-12:09+0000) multi-cajffs2_scan_inod
e_node(): CRC failed on node at 0x00054ba4: Read 0xffffffff, calculated 0x0c387b
71
jffs2_scan_eraseblock(): Node at 0x0005ab08 {0x1985, 0xe002, 0xffffffff) has inv
alid CRC 0xffffffff (calculated 0x0be58754)
Using /lib/modules/2.4.20/misc/i2c-8xx.o
[i2c-8xx]: mpc 8xx i2c init
i2c-core.o: adapter registered as adapter 0.
[i2c-8xx]: adapter: 0
Using /lib/modules/2.4.20/misc/info.o
i2c-core.o: driver FOR_PROBE_ONLY registered.
i2c-core.o: driver unregistered: FOR_PROBE_ONLY
Using /lib/modules/2.4.20/misc/event.o
event: init ...
Using /lib/modules/2.4.20/misc/avs.o
i2c-core.o: driver i2c audio/video switch driver registered.
i2c-core.o: client [CXA2126] registered to adapter [](pos. 0).
Using /lib/modules/2.4.20/misc/saa7126.o
i2c-core.o: driver i2c saa7126 driver registered.
i2c-core.o: client [i2c saa7126 chip] registered to adapter [](pos. 1).
Using /lib/modules/2.4.20/misc/fp.o
i2c-core.o: driver DBox2 Frontprocessor driver registered.
i2c-core.o: client [DBox2 Frontprocessor client] registered to adapter [](pos. 2
).
Using /lib/modules/2.4.20/misc/dvb_demux.o
Using /lib/modules/2.4.20/misc/dvbdev.o
Using /lib/modules/2.4.20/misc/avia.o
AVIA: $Id: avia_core.c,v 1.35.2.1 2003/02/18 14:53:34 alexw Exp $
Using /lib/modules/2.4.20/misc/lcd.o
lcd.o: init lcd driver module
lcd.o: found KS0713/SED153X lcd interface on 3
Using /lib/modules/2.4.20/misc/cam.o
der moment ist gekommen...
Oops: kernel access of bad area, sig: 11
NIP: C000AA90 XER: 00000000 LR: C38E4898 SP: C1CE1E30 REGS: c1ce1d80 TRAP: 0300
Not tainted
MSR: 00009032 EE: 1 PR: 0 FP: 0 ME: 1 IR/DR: 11
DAR: C391E000, DSISR: C0000000
TASK = c1ce0000[38] 'insmod' Last syscall: 6
last math 00000000 last altivec 00000000
GPR00: 00000000 C1CE1E30 C1CE0000 C38E8000 C391DFFC 00020000 C38FCFFC BA9F9938
GPR08: 000207A4 C38E0000 C38C0000 C000AA74 24002089 00000000 00000000 00000000
GPR16: 00000000 00000000 00000000 00000000 00009032 01CE1F40 C1CE1EA8 10076260
GPR24: C1AE7000 C1AE81E0 C0130000 C3909000 C0140000 00068D58 FFFFFFFF FF0009C0
Call backtrace:
C38E4878 C38E4BA0 C38E5184 C0010188 C00025DC 10017A34 10018F18
10003C84 10003890 0FEF5370 00000000
Segmentation fault
Using /lib/modules/2.4.20/misc/dmxdev.o
write 1 event's ...
write 1 event's ...
Using /lib/modules/2.4.20/misc/dvb_frontend.o
[LCDFONT] initializing core...
[LCDFONT] adding font /share/fonts/micron_bold.ttf...OK (Micron/Bold)
[LCDFONT] Intializing font cache...
[LCDFONT] FTC_Face_Requester (Micron/Bold)
Using /lib/modules/2.4.20/misc/avia_gt.o
avia_gt_core: $Id: avia_gt_core.c,v 1.23.4.1 2003/02/18 14:32:46 alexw Exp $
avia_gt_core: autodetecting chip type... AViA eNX found
avia_gt_enx: $Id: avia_gt_enx.c,v 1.13 2002/09/02 19:25:37 Jolt Exp $
avia_gt_accel: $Id: avia_gt_accel.c,v 1.8.4.1 2003/02/18 14:32:46 alexw Exp $
avia_gt_dmx: $Id: avia_gt_dmx.c,v 1.139.2.1.2.1 2003/02/18 14:32:46 alexw Exp $
avia_gt_dmx: Successfully loaded ucode VB1.7
ENX-INITed -> 0
there MIGHT be no TS

avia_gt_dmx: warning, misaligned queue 0 (is 0x32A00, size 65536), aligning...
avia_gt_gv: $Id: avia_gt_gv.c,v 1.25.4.2 2003/03/04 08:44:39 zwen Exp $
avia_gt_gv: set_input_size (width=720, height=576)
avia_gt_pcm: $Id: avia_gt_pcm.c,v 1.19.4.1 2003/02/18 14:32:46 alexw Exp $
avia_gt_capture: $Id: avia_gt_capture.c,v 1.22 2002/08/22 13:39:33 Jolt Exp $
avia_gt_pig: $Id: avia_gt_pig.c,v 1.28 2002/08/22 13:39:33 Jolt Exp $
avia_gt_ir: $Id: avia_gt_ir.c,v 1.19 2002/08/22 13:39:33 Jolt Exp $
avia_gt_core: Loaded AViA eNX/GTX driver
Using /lib/modules/2.4.20/misc/dvb.o
dvb.c: init_dvb
Init VES1993
Using /lib/modules/2.4.20/misc/ves1993.o
i2c-core.o: driver VES1993 DVB DECODER registered.
i2c-core.o: client [VES1993] registered to adapter [](pos. 3).
i2c-core.o: driver sp5659/tsa5059 tuner driver registered.
i2c-core.o: client [DBox2 Tuner Driver] registered to adapter [](pos. 4).
VES1993: sp5659 tuner found
Using /lib/modules/2.4.20/misc/avia_gt_napi.o
avia_gt_napi: $Id: avia_gt_napi.c,v 1.141.2.1.2.1 2003/02/18 14:32:46 alexw Exp
$
avia_gt_napi: hardware section filtering disabled.
Using /lib/modules/2.4.20/misc/avia_gt_vbi.o
avia_gt_vbi: $Id: avia_gt_vbi.c,v 1.17.4.1 2003/02/18 14:32:46 alexw Exp $
avia_gt_vbi: got demux C-Cube - AViA eNX/GTX
Using /lib/modules/2.4.20/misc/avia_gt_fb.o
avia_gt_fb: $Id: avia_gt_fb_core.c,v 1.38.4.4 2003/03/04 08:44:39 zwen Exp $
avia_gt_gv: set_input_mode (mode=2)
avia_gt_gv: set_input_size (width=720, height=576)
avia_gt_gv: set_input_mode (mode=2)
avia_gt_gv: set_input_size (width=720, height=576)
avia_gt_gv: set_input_mode (mode=2)
avia_gt_gv: set_input_size (width=720, height=576)
Console: switching to colour frame buffer device 82x32
avia_gt_fb: fb0: AViA eNX/GTX Framebuffer frame buffer device
Using /lib/modules/2.4.20/misc/avia_gt_oss.o
avia_oss: $Id: avia_gt_oss.c,v 1.12.4.1 2003/02/18 14:32:46 alexw Exp $
Using /lib/modules/2.4.20/misc/avia_gt_lirc.o
avia_gt_lirc: $Id: avia_gt_lirc.c,v 1.4 2002/08/22 13:39:33 Jolt Exp $
cdkVcInfo $Id: cdkVcInfo.c,v 1.2 2003/03/02 23:28:32 alexW Exp $
$Id: sectionsd.cpp,v 1.164 2003/03/03 13:38:33 obi Exp $
caching 504 hours
events are old 60min after their end time
$Id: zapit.cpp,v 1.290.2.12 2003/03/03 11:18:41 alexw Exp $
/var/tuxbox/config/zapit/services.xml: No such file or directory
Controld $Id: controld.cpp,v 1.99 2003/03/04 16:33:16 alexw Exp $
[controld] Boxtype detected: (2)
set event: 00000009
[nhttpd] Neutrino HTTP-Server starting..
[neutrino] NeutrinoNG $Id: neutrino.cpp,v 1.421 2003/03/03 22:19:15 mws Exp $
[neutrino] frameBuffer Instance created
1024k video mem
avia_gt_gv: set_input_mode (mode=2)
avia_gt_gv: set_input_size (width=720, height=576)
[neutrino] enable flash
[neutrino] Software update enabled
[lcdd] time-skin not found -> using default...
[lcdd] weekday-skin not found -> using default...
[lcdd] date-skin not found -> using default...
[lcdd] month-skin not found -> using default...
[LCDFONT] initializing core...
[LCDFONT] adding font /share/fonts/micron.ttf...OK (Micron/Regular)
[LCDFONT] Intializing font cache...
[LCDFONT] FTC_Face_Requester (Micron/Regular)
IP : 192.168.19.99
Netmask : 255.255.255.0
Broadcast: 192.168.19.255
Gateway :
[neutrino] menue setup
[CHTTPUpdater] HTTP-Basepath: http://dboxupdate.berlios.de/images/
[CHTTPUpdater] Image-Filename: cdk.cramfs
[CHTTPUpdater] Version-Filename: cdk.cramfs.version
loading locales: scandir: No such file or directory
[neutrino] control event register
[neutrino] sectionsd event register
[neutrino] zapit event register
[neutrino] timerd event register
[sectionsd] getUTC: read: Connection timed out
[sectionsd] getUTC: read: Connection timed out
sieht zwar alles normal aus, es werden aber keine Sender gefunden. Der Sendesuchlauf wird nach ca. 30 sec normal beendet, es sind aber immer noch keine Sender da.
Was habe ich falsch gemach???
p.s.
die in der bootlog angemeckerte services.xml befindet sich im angegebenen Verzeichnis.